"Ready in the Rhythm Section" The Syndromes vs The Merciful Release All-Stars featuring The Impossible Dreamers

Found this LP on ebay and ordered it...Anyone got any background information on it? Not a bad record really, am just listening to the b-side ("The Merciful Release All-Stars")

Has an insert (hand-written and copied) stating Merciful Release is "an organisation through which "independent"ideas can be thrust upon the general public". Adress given as 78 Sussex Square, London W2

The Impossible Dreamers were a 1980s new-wave band that had a major club hit with their 12� single “Spin�, before signing for RCA Records where they were produced by Johnny Marr (The Smiths). The band members have gone on to work with Robert Plant, The Pretenders and The Lilac Time.
